ENGLISH SPELLING
English was first written down in the 6th century. At that time, writers had to use the twenty- three
letters of the Latin alphabet (0) _____. Because English has sounds that do not exist in Latin, they added
letters (1) _____. This resulted in some irregular spelling. After the Norman invasion of England in 1066,
French became the language spoken by the king and other people in positions of power and influence. Many
French words were introduced and the spelling of many English words changed (2) _____. The result was a
rich and irregular mix of spellings.

The printing press was invented in the 15th century. Many early printers of English texts spoke other first
languages, especially Dutch. They often paid little attention (3) _____. Sometimes technical decisions were
made to give columns of print straight edges. To do this, letters were taken off the ends of words and
sometimes added to words. With time, people became used (4) _____. Fixed spellings were therefore created
by the printers’ decisions. Spoken English, however, was not fixed. It continued (5) _____. It is no wonder that
English spelling seems irregular. Words such as although, through and cough, for example, all have the same
spelling at the end, but are pronounced differently. Words such as feet, meat and seize, on the other hand, are
spelled differently but have the same sound in the middle.

The causes of headaches, whether they are a common kind of tension or migraine headaches, or any
other kinds, are usually the same. During periods of stress, muscles in the neck, head and face are contracted
so tightly that they exert tremendous pressure on the nerves beneath them; headaches, taking many forms
from a constant, dull pain to an insistent hammering result. Although at least 50% of American adults are
estimated to suffer one or more headaches per week, it is the 20 million migraine sufferers who are in
special difficulties. Migraines, which are mostly suffered by women, can involve tremendous, unrelieved
pain.
Migraines, which may also be caused by stress, can occur in people who bottle up their emotions and
who are very conscientious in their performance. Escaping from stressful situations, being open with one’s
feeling, lowering one’s expectations can help reduce the stress and so cut down on those headaches which
cannot be “helped” by aspirin and other non-prescription painkillers.
